Rehabmart.com, an online e-commerce company that sells rehabilitation and medical supplies, has joined into a distribution partnership with The Wedge Group, LLC, to offer their ingenious drinking device for those who suffer with dysphagia and swallowing disorders to a larger consumer market base. The Wedge Group, headquartered in Des Allemands, Louisiana, has patented this revolutionary invention as the Wedge Cup®. This extraordinary cup is the ideal solution for any patient with injuries or swallowing disorders that tend to make drinking from regular cups difficult, or, because of the risk of aspiration, even dangerous. This includes patients with decreased strength, limited muscle control, those recovering from arm or neck injuries or those with limited range of arm, or upper body range of motion. Specifically designed to easily dispense thickened liquids, the Wedge Cup® also works well with any liquids.

Bryan Bergeron invented the Wedge Cup® as a labor of love for his brother, Roy, who because of contracting spinal meningitis at the age of five months old, was left severely handicapped, mentally and physically. After the death of their parents, Bryan became solely responsible for Roy’s welfare and he attended numerous meetings with his therapists and caregivers through the years, including a swallow study meeting about eleven years ago. Roy had been having trouble drinking liquids, and Bryan was told that finding a cup that worked well for him had not been an easy task thus far. The therapists recommended that his cup always be filled above the halfway point to eliminate the necessity of having to tilt his head back to get ‘every drop’. Because of Roy’s dysphagia, tilting the head back when drinking liquids could potentially cause aspiration of tiny amounts to enter his lungs, which could lead to pneumonia. When Bryan suggested that they get him a cup with a wedge inside of it, the speech-language pathologist informed him that there were none available on the market, and he should go home and make one…which is exactly what he did.

He approached Tulane University’s Biochemical Engineering Department with his wedge cup prototype to perform a peer study. Graduate student, Alyssa Alta performed a comparative test with seven other containers, including several commonly used for dysphagia and swallowing disorders. This tilt/flow study found that Bryan’s wedge cup completely emptied at a small series of tilt angles comparatively to the other cups, and also found that its average volume per angle was greater than all of the other dysphagia cups on the market. It additionally finished dispensing all of its contents sooner than all of the other cups tested, as well. Bryan also received input from therapists while attending a speech and language conference for the Veteran’s Association in Tucson, Arizona that they would like some type of locking device to keep patients from moving the adjustable flow control. From that suggestion, he created a lock under the lid which is now a standard feature of the Wedge Cup®.

Popular keynote speaker, healthcare futurist, and best-selling author, Jack Uldrich has been selected to deliver the keynote address at the University of Southern California’s Division of Biokinesiology and Physical Therapy’s annual meeting in Palm Springs, California on Friday, May 18th. He will be discussing short and long-term trends in biokinesiology, physical therapy and health care. In June, Uldrich be discussing key technological trends in health care with members of the hospital associations in Maryland (June 5th), Mississippi (June 8th) and Maine (June 22nd).

The presentations, based on Uldrich’s two new books: “Foresight 20/20: A Futurist Explores the Trends Transforming Tomorrow” and “Higher Unlearning: 39 Post Requisite Lessons for Achieving a Successful Future” as well as his popular article, “Top Ten Trends in Healthcare,” will begin by discussing how continued advances in information technologies, biotechnology, nanotechnology, robotics, radio frequency identification (RFID) technology, genomics, regenerative medicine and social networking will radically transform healthcare in the decade ahead. (A video of Mr. Uldrich discussing future trends can be viewed here.)

Uldrich will then focus on why these trends will demand unlearning and discuss why participants must embrace the concept of unlearning in order to achieve future success. Uldrich, who has been hailed as “America’s Chief Unlearning Officer,” will conclude by reviewing specific habits, customs, beliefs and ideas that healthcare professionals can—and must—unlearn. Throughout his talks, he will use vivid analogies and memorable stories, drawn from a wide spectrum of industries, to ensure his message of unlearning “sticks” with his audiences.
